2017-01-23 8 views

答えて

-1

変数はブロックに対してローカルです。ブロック内のコードは実行されます。変数は範囲外になります。まず、aがグローバルに定義されます.2番目のケースでは、関数内で定義されます。どちらも同じではないaが異なる。

+0

"2番目のケースでは、関数内で定義されています"。いいえ、そうではありません。両方ともグローバルです。 – kaylum

関連する問題